Students at Rajiv Gandhi Proudyogiki Vishwavidyalaya (RGPV), a premier technical university in Madhya Pradesh, have alleged a shocking incident involving a lizard discovered in their meal at the campus canteen. The episode, which occurred on March 18, has sparked outrage and led to the formation of an inquiry committee after a video went viral on social media.

Incident Details and Viral Video

During lunch hour at the Gandhinagar campus canteen, a group of students, including engineering undergraduates, noticed what appeared to be a lifeless lizard floating in their curry. Upon confronting the canteen staff, a worker reportedly picked up the object, consumed it in front of the crowd, chewed, and swallowed it, declaring, "Yeh toh shimla mirchi ka tukda hai" (This is just a capsicum piece).

The video of this act quickly spread online, garnering thousands of views and dividing netizens. Some mocked the worker's "ultimate taste test," while others criticized the university's hygiene standards. An eyewitness, a third-year student who requested anonymity, expressed horror, stating, "We were horrified; how can he eat something like that to prove a point?"

University Response and Student Demands

In response to the viral clip, RGPV announced the formation of an inquiry committee on Sunday to investigate the allegations. Director RGPV (UIT) Sudhir Bhadoriya emphasized, "We take student welfare seriously and will ensure strict action if lapses are found."

Students are now demanding that the canteen be shut down until the probe is completed, citing concerns over food safety and cleanliness. The incident has raised broader questions about hygiene practices in educational institution cafeterias across the region.
